1. What are Zyn nicotine pouches?
Zyn nic pouches contain nicotine, flavourings and organic silica granules wrapped in a cotton pillow. The pouch is placed under your top lip where time-released nicotine will keep your cravings at bay for up to 45 minutes. They provide a completely tobacco free experience for smokers who wish to adopt a healthier lifestyle. Zyn nicotine pouches are up to 80% cheaper than smoking, they’re environmentally friendly and you can use them anywhere.
2. How strong are Zyn pouches?
The nicotine strength ranges from light 1.5mg - 3mg options, medium 6mg - 9.5mg and stronger 12.5mg options.
Depending on the brand, what some may consider strong, or extra strong, others may label mild or medium strength. In the UK, the spectrum of nicotine strength in pouches ranges from 1.5mg to 30mg per pouch. In Zyn’s case, their ‘strong’ is a 6mg strength which generally is considered mild or a beginner level (social smoker) level. XX-Strong is a 12.5mg strength which sits about halfway between what is available.
That being said, the nicotine pouch industry could do with standardisation when it comes to grading nicotine strength on their packaging. Some brands use wording like X-Strong, others use a 5-dot visual system, and some may list the nicotine strength in total weight (mg/g) or mg per pouch. At Alternix we feel that mg per pouch is the more accurate measurement and we’ll be using that when mentioning nicotine pouch strength in this review.

Flavour Profile: Espressino - Strong - 6mg
First impressions
Initially, I was greeted with a milky note of smooth cream, which slowly developed into a robust coffee flavour. Subtle notes of chocolate bring a good amount of sweetness and the full-bodied roasted coffee flavour is accurate and balanced. I hate having to bin a nic pouch early because the flavour is too intense, and thankfully this wasn't the case with Espressino, which provided a gradual release of sweet and creamy coffee that didn’t overwhelm me at all.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
I picked up the cream note within the first five minutes, followed by a distinctive note of coffee and sugar. The Espressino flavour peaks at around the 10 minute mark.
How long does it last for?
I used the ‘mini’ version which fit comfortably and was a pleasant change from the slim size as it is much flatter. This does however mean that the pouch lasts for up to 30 minutes. I can report though, that the flavour is consistent for the full half an hour.
Is the flavour accurate?
Yes. This tastes like coffee. My only criticism is that this is supposed to be an espresso, so I would have liked a more robust coffee note and less sweetness and cream. I would class this more as a cappuccino or latte flavour - but it's still good.
Who would like this?
Zyn Espressino will delight coffee lovers with its smoothness and rich flavour. That said, it could also win over a lot of mint users, who may find it a welcome change to the constant kick of menthol. Espressino is the obvious choice for your morning nic pouch and its balanced flavours and sweetness will see coffee lovers savouring it all day.





Flavour Profile: Citrus - Strong - 6mg
First impressions
Opening the can I noticed the promising aroma of lemon and lime. So I popped one in and waited, and waited. The flavour does capture the classic taste of hard boiled lemon sweets, but it is very muted. I had to lick the pouch to really get a sense of what it tasted like, which was quite nice but not something you want to be doing all the time. There is a good blend of acidic lemon and sweet lime but it needs more punch.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
After 10 minutes there is a very mild note of lemon with an undernote of lime, the flavour of Zyn Citrus doesn't reach heights greater than this.
How long does it last for?
The citrus flavour is consistent throughout the 30 minute lifespan of the pouch and unfortunately, it remains very subtle.
Is the flavour accurate?
Yes, you can taste a well balanced combination of lemons and limes, just.
Who would like this?
This might be the perfect pouch for people who don’t want an overpowering taste in their mouth. Citrus is a background flavour that would make an ideal option for everyday use.



Flavour Profile: Icy Mint - Strong - 9.5mg
First impressions
Zyn Icy Mint is a flavour that doesn’t waste any time. A cool ice note hits you almost immediately and the mint builds rapidly within the first 5 minutes. The cool ice note is localised around the gums and the mint flavour is all there and develops as the top note on the tongue. I’m reminded of chewing a stick of fresh minty gum.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
The pouch's moistness definitely increases the flavour's rapidity - it’s almost instantaneous, a chill of ice as soon as you place the pouch followed by a strong mint flavour.
How long does it last for?
Icy Mint lasted for the entire pouch duration, about 45 minutes as we tested the slim size. Cool Ice from the pouch and a robust peppermint flavour in the mouth.
Is the flavour accurate?
Absolutely. This icy mint pouch does what it says on the tin. I would have preferred the ice to spread beyond the confines of the pouch but it's a small niggle.
Who would like this?
Anyone looking for strong minty refreshment will love this combination of arctic coolness and spicy mint, it's like chewing a fresh stick of icy mint gum.





Flavour Profile: Icy Blackcurrant - XX-Strong - 12.5mg
First impressions
Icy Blackcurrant is simply moreish, I was enveloped with a berry aroma as I opened the tub, and the moistness of the pouches made the flavour hit immediately. Imagine biting down on a plump and juicy blackcurrant you've just picked from a countryside ramble. It's the dominant note here, there is loads of flavour that fills the mouth with sweet and tangy berries and the ice come in behind to add a touch of fresh excitement to the experience.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
Within seconds your mouth is filled with juicy blackcurrant flavour, the ice takes a little longer to develop but it's there.
How long does it last for?
A strong burst of flavour for the first 15 minutes that mellowed throughout the remaining 45 minutes of use that I got out of the 12.5mg slim pouch, which is ideal for stronger nicotine cravings. However, in this instance, the loss of flavour served as a timely indication that the pouch was finished.
Is the flavour accurate?
The stand-out quality of Zyn Icy Blackcurrant is it's accuracy, I was anticipating a blackcurrant candy or wine gum flavour, but not so, this is fresh berry fruit all the way.
Who would like this?
If fresh, authentic blackcurrant fruit is what you're after then you are going to love Icy Blackcurrant. It is a rich and refreshing berry fruit delight and one of the best Zyn flavours in the bunch.





Flavour Profile: Cool Mint - Strong - 9.5mg
First impressions
Cool Mint is a very mild flavour reminiscent of peppermint chewing gum. A hint of menthol sits nicely in the background with peppermint being the dominant note. The taste is accurate, if quite subtle which I think would suit anyone who likes mint but doesn’t want it too strong.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
The pouch is dry, so the flavour took about 5 minutes to develop. The menthol note is the first to come through followed by a light mint.
How long does it last for?
Cool Mint peaks at about the 20-minute mark and then drops off. It is a very muted flavour to begin with, so I wasn’t expecting it to be that noticeable towards the end, which it isn’t.
Is the flavour accurate?
Zyn Cool Mint hits the marks for accurate peppermint flavour with a suggestion of cooling menthol.
Who would like this?
Lovers of refreshing mint flavours looking for an easy all day pouch that doesn’t overwhelm your senses will find Cool Mint the perfect fit.





Flavour Profile: Chili Guava - X-Strong - 11mg
First impressions
Zyn Chili Guava is a flavour I saved for last as I enjoy both these flavours and I was not disappointed. Smooth tropical fruit and a warm blaze of chili come in swinging, delivering an expert balance of sweetness and a moderate level of heat. Most of the heat is localised around the pouch, whilst exotic fruit develops on the palate. I also noticed a welcome hint of spice from the chili on my tongue - a tasty and exciting flavour.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
This is a moist pouch that takes seconds to release its tantalising combination of flavours.
How long does it last for?
A good balance of fruit and spice was present throughout the 45 minute duration of the pouch. The heat from the chili does begin to dissipate halfway through but the spicy flavour remains.
Is the flavour accurate?
The guava notes are rich and on point and the chili delivers a blazing kick that has just the right level of heat.
Who would like this?
Zyn’s Chili Guava is a fun flavour that makes for a welcome change for anyone who wants a break from traditional mint and fruit combinations.




Flavour Profile: Apple Mint
First Impressions
Apple Mint hits with a refreshing note of crisp green apples, lifted by a sprig of cool peppermint. The sweet-sour apple base works well with the mellow mint, making for a surprisingly balanced and clean flavour. It’s more subtle than the icy mint options, and ideal if you want something fruity without straying too far into sweet-shop territory.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
Starts developing within 10–15 seconds. The crisp apple comes through first, with mint kicking in shortly after to round it off.
How long does it last for?
Around 30–35 minutes. The mint lingers the longest, while the apple fades slightly towards the end.
Is the flavour accurate?
Yes. The apple flavour feels clean and natural, more like a Granny Smith than a candy apple. The mint balances it nicely without overpowering.
Who would like this?
Great choice for anyone who wants something refreshing and fruity without going full ice or full sweet. An easy all-day flavour for pouch users who like a bit of zing.




Flavour Profile: Red Fruits
First Impressions
Zyn Red Fruits is a bold mix that blends strawberry, raspberry and a tart rhubarb twist. There’s a cool menthol finish, but it’s more of a supporting act here. The result is a rich, complex flavour with a slightly herbal edge. Not one for everyone, but undeniably unique and surprisingly moreish once you’re used to it.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
Flavour starts developing within the first minute, with layers unfolding over time. Rhubarb and menthol come in after a couple of minutes.
How long does it last for?
Lasts around 35–40 minutes. The berry notes linger, while the menthol fades toward the end.
Is the flavour accurate?
It’s a pretty ambitious blend, but it works. Strawberry and raspberry are clear, and the rhubarb adds a sharp, distinctive twist.
Who would like this?
Best for users who like their pouches complex and enjoy bold, tangy flavours with a bit of menthol bite.




Flavour Profile: Spearmint
First Impressions
Spearmint offers a softer mint experience compared to Icy Mint or Cool Mint. It’s sweet, mellow, and reminiscent of spearmint gum – refreshing without the harsh freeze. This makes it a solid pick for those who want a minty option that’s easier on the sinuses and not overly intense.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
Instant. The sweet spearmint flavour is there from the first minute and remains stable throughout.
How long does it last for?
30–40 minutes, depending on how moist the pouch is. Flavour remains consistent and doesn’t wear out quickly.
Is the flavour accurate?
Yes – it’s smooth, slightly sweet, and very much like spearmint chewing gum. Less medicinal than menthol or peppermint.
Who would like this?
Best suited to ex-smokers who liked menthols but want a gentler, gum-like mint flavour. Also ideal for everyday, casual use.




Flavour Profile: Blackcurrant Frost
First Impressions
Think of Blackcurrant Frost as the cooler sibling to Icy Blackcurrant. It’s still rich and fruity but has a heavier menthol note that dials up the refreshment. Slightly drier on the tongue than Icy Blackcurrant, this pouch tastes more like a lozenge flavour that’s crisp, clean, and long-lasting.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
Flavour builds quickly – within 15–20 seconds you get that fruity hit, with frost kicking in not long after.
How long does it last for?
A full 35–40 minutes. The frosty sensation outlasts the blackcurrant slightly, but both hold up well.
Is the flavour accurate?
The blackcurrant is rich and full-bodied, while the menthol doesn’t overwhelm – just enough to keep things sharp.
Who would like this?
Perfect for users who want a fruit-ice combo with a bit more bite than Icy Blackcurrant. If you liked berry lozenges, you’ll love this.



Flavour Profile: Menthol Ice
First Impressions
Zyn Menthol Ice strips things back to basics – pure menthol with no frills. It’s strong, clean and delivers a consistent cooling effect throughout use. If you’re switching from menthol cigarettes or just want a no-nonsense refresh, this will do the job without any distracting fruity extras.
How long does the flavour take to develop?
Pretty much immediate. You get that menthol punch in the first 5 seconds.
How long does it last for?
Solid 30 minutes, with the cold sensation staying steady and tapering slowly.
Is the flavour accurate?
Yes – it’s pure menthol, no flavour additives or sweetness. Very clean, very cooling.
Who would like this?
This one’s for the purists — menthol smokers, pouch veterans, or anyone needing a brain freeze in pouch form. Not for the faint-hearted.
